Lemon Tree, The Description
The Lemon Tree is a comfortable, 11-bedroom hotel in Wrexham town centre. The contemporary style and authentic flavours of its Italian restaurant recreate a host of Mediterranean memories. Carmine and Colette de Pasquale offer a wonderful blend of home-cooked Italian food, comfortable accommodation and warm hospitality.
The "neo-gothic" style building on Rhosddu Road has a long history. It was designed by a local Wrexham architect, James Reynolds Gummow, built as a private residence in 1865 and named "Abbotsfield". At some stage it became the Denbighshire and Clwyd Area Education Office; during the war years, one wing was given over to "The Abbotsfield Priory War Nursery".
In 1982 it opened as an hotel, retaining both the Abbotsfield Priory name and many of the features from the original building. It also had a spell as the "Graffiti Italiano", before its current transformation by new owners into The Lemon Tree.
Head Chef, Carmine, from Abruzzo, infuses all his cuisine with genuine Italian passion. The aromas from the kitchen let you know you have the genuine article. Flexibility, or as they say in Italy, "siamo flessibile", is the key when it comes to their menus. You can pop in for a bowl of delicious pasta or you can linger over a full-blown Italian extravaganza. Parties are welcome with menus selected to suit.
Every dish on their menu is home-cooked using the very best in fresh seasonal and local ingredients. You could start your meal with a mouth-watering range of antipasti, fresh homemade soups or seafood. For pasta lovers there's a huge choice of well-known and original dishes plus Carmine's award-winning risotto.
Main courses may include meat or fish dishes in quintessential Italian sauces or a typical rich flavoured steak with balsamic roasted red onion and Dolcelatte cheese whilst a wide range of vegetable and cheese dishes make the menus eminently accessible for those wanting a vegetarian option.
Sweets are always an Italian love and Carmine's menus include classic tiramisu, with sponge biscuits soaked in Amaretto, and crostata di cioccolata, a dark chocolate tartlet with sweetened mascarpone cream.
